Básicos de Laravel

Instalaciones

  1. XAMPP
  2. Editor de código
  3. Composer
  4. Crear un proyecto Laravel

Dinámica básica Laravel

Ruta (url)

Controlador

Modelo

Vista

request

response

Ruta     Vista

Ruta (url)

Vista

request

response

Ruta (url)

Controlador

Vista

request

response

Ruta     Vista     Controlador

Base de datos

  1. La conexión se hace mediante el archivo .env
  2. Con migraciones nosotros podríamos crear todo el esquema de base de datos de nuestra aplicación, haciendo que sea más fácil de compartir y de mantener.
  3. Cada tabla de la base de datos puede ser representada por un Modelo

Ruta (url)

Controlador

Modelo

Vista

request

response

Ruta    Vista    Controlador    Modelo

Eloquent

Laravel incluye eloquent que es un ORM (Object Relational Mapper) el cual permite realizar consultas y peticiones a una base de datos sin escribir SQL directamente.

 

En laravel un Modelo representa a una tabla en nuestra base de datos.

Categories

Relaciones entre tablas

Made with Slides.com